Northbound, the ships will depart on Wednesdays from Panama and Fridays from Costa Rica, then arrive on Tuesdays in Port Everglades and on Wednesdays in Jacksonville. Steve Collar, Crowley Senior Vice President and General Manager, International Liner Services, said:
“Crowley’s ocean cargo service blends seamlessly with our logistics offerings to provide customers a single point of accountability, increased visibility and reduced costs while building on the confidence they already have in the company’s regular, fast ocean transport service.”
“The new, dedicated service continues our strategy of providing importers and exporters the fastest, most dependable suite of supply chain solutions possible between the US and Central American regions,” commented Crowley’s Frank Larkin, Senior Vice President and General Manager, Logistics and Commercial Services.
